This hiking route will take you through the beautiful area of Cypress Provincial Park, with a total distance of 5.984 kilometers and an elevation gain of 475 meters. The duration of the hike is estimated to be around 2 hours and 34 minutes, with a moderate difficulty level.
As you start your journey, you will come across Cypress Creek Lodge, a great spot for a quick break or meal before hitting the trail. Along the way, you will pass by Hollyburn Mountain, offering stunning views of the surrounding landscape. Make sure to stop by Heather Lake, located about 3 kilometers into the hike, for a peaceful and scenic rest by the water.
If you're in need of water, there is a drinking water station about 0.06 kilometers from the start of the trail. Additionally, there are parking areas both at the beginning of the trail and about 0.12 kilometers into the hike, making it convenient for hikers to access the route.
Before embarking on this adventure, remember to bring plenty of water, snacks, and to check the weather forecast. With varying terrain and beautiful scenery along the way, this out-and-back route to Heather Lake promises a rewarding hiking experience for outdoor enthusiasts.
